#350f1c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#350f1c is composed of 20.8% red, 5.9% green and 11%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 71.7% magenta, 47.2% yellow and 79.2% black. It has a hue angle of 339.5 degrees, a saturation of 55.9% and a lightness of 13.3%. #350f1c color hex could be obtained by blending #6a1e38 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#330033.

Shades and Tints of #350f1c

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#070204 is the darkest color, while #fdf7f9 is the lightest one.

Tones of #350f1c

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#232122 is the less saturated color, while #420218 is the most saturated one.
